Understanding Regulatory-Weighted Assets (RWA)

Regulatory-Weighted Assets (RWA) represent a crucial component of the banking sector's balance sheet. These assets are weighted according to their riskiness, thereby influencing the amount of capital banks must hold against them. This regulatory framework ensures financial stability and protects depositors and the economy from systemic risks. RWA includes a broad spectrum of assets, such as loans, mortgages, and certain securities, each carrying distinct risk profiles.

Key Components of AI Risk Management

Data Governance

At the heart of AI risk management lies data governance. Given the reliance on data-driven insights, ensuring data quality, integrity, and security is paramount. Financial institutions must establish stringent data management practices, including data validation, data cleansing, and data privacy measures. This foundation supports accurate AI model training and reliable risk assessments.

Model Risk Management

AI models used in RWA must undergo rigorous validation and oversight. Model risk management encompasses the entire lifecycle of AI models, from development and deployment to monitoring and updating. Key considerations include:

Model Validation: Ensuring models are accurate, reliable, and unbiased. This involves extensive backtesting, stress testing, and scenario analysis. Bias and Fairness: AI models must be scrutinized for any biases that could lead to unfair outcomes or regulatory non-compliance. Transparency: Models should provide clear insights into how predictions and decisions are made, facilitating regulatory scrutiny and stakeholder trust. Regulatory Compliance

Navigating the regulatory landscape is a significant challenge for AI risk management in RWA. Financial institutions must stay abreast of evolving regulations and ensure that AI systems comply with relevant laws and guidelines. This includes:

Documentation and Reporting: Comprehensive documentation of AI processes and outcomes is essential for regulatory review. Audit Trails: Maintaining detailed records of AI decision-making processes to facilitate audits and compliance checks. Collaboration with Regulators: Engaging with regulatory bodies to understand expectations and incorporate feedback into AI governance frameworks.

Real-World Applications

Credit Risk Assessment

AI has revolutionized credit risk assessment in RWA by analyzing vast datasets to identify patterns and predict creditworthiness more accurately. For instance, machine learning algorithms can process historical data, socio-economic indicators, and alternative data sources to generate credit scores that are both precise and unbiased.

Fraud Detection

AI-driven fraud detection systems analyze transaction patterns in real-time, identifying anomalies that may indicate fraudulent activity. By employing advanced algorithms and neural networks, these systems can detect subtle indicators of fraud that traditional rule-based systems might miss, thereby enhancing the security of financial transactions.

Regulatory Reporting

Automated AI systems can streamline regulatory reporting by extracting and analyzing data from various sources, generating compliant reports that meet regulatory requirements. This not only reduces the administrative burden on compliance teams but also minimizes the risk of errors and omissions.
